From 11bad6f75cf380e94805c097e68b41259e7d7b4f Mon Sep 17 00:00:00 2001
From: Leyla Farazha <leyla@lindenlab.com>
Date: Wed, 19 Oct 2011 13:43:27 -0700
Subject: [PATCH] EXP-1352 Red directional arrow shown on teleport screen when
 selecting a destination from the destinations floater to teleport to

---
 indra/newview/lltracker.cpp |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/indra/newview/lltracker.cpp b/indra/newview/lltracker.cpp
index 983108391f8..efe9bb8da7c 100644
--- a/indra/newview/lltracker.cpp
+++ b/indra/newview/lltracker.cpp
@@ -53,10 +53,12 @@
 #include "llinventorymodel.h"
 #include "llinventoryobserver.h"
 #include "lllandmarklist.h"
+#include "llprogressview.h"
 #include "llsky.h"
 #include "llui.h"
 #include "llviewercamera.h"
 #include "llviewerinventory.h"
+#include "llviewerwindow.h"
 #include "llworld.h"
 #include "llworldmapview.h"
 #include "llviewercontrol.h"
@@ -111,6 +113,8 @@ void LLTracker::drawHUDArrow()
 {
 	if (!gSavedSettings.getBOOL("RenderTrackerBeacon")) return;
 
+	if (gViewerWindow->getProgressView()->getVisible()) return;
+
 	static LLUIColor map_track_color = LLUIColorTable::instance().getColor("MapTrackColor", LLColor4::white);
 	
 	/* tracking autopilot destination has been disabled 
-- 
GitLab